Lightning strike design test and verification of composite laminates

Abstract: In order to verify the effectiveness of lightning strike protection design for aircraft carbon fiber composite material structure, a series of lightning strike tests were designed, which were based on multiple sizes of copper wire mesh with different densities and multiple sorts of aircraft lightning zones. The test results were evaluated through different methods, including the visual damage observation, thermal imaging observation and ultrasonic nondestructive testing. The lightning damage degrees and characteristics of carbon fiber composite laminates were compared and analyzed. Based on the tests, the damage situation of six different zones on the aircraft were studied, and the specimens were classified and analyzed according to the damage severity, and the composite lightning protection design measures were effective, which could ensure the flight safety of a certain type of aircraft composite structure after lightning strikes. It is recommended that the current CU195 copper mesh should be used in Zone one,but there are still optimization space. Now it is advisable to use copper mesh specification of CU142. In addition, the reasonable suggestions about the copper mesh sizes for other lightning zones have been given. It has important reference value for other similar composite material structure.

Key words: composite laminates, lightning strike protection, copper wire mesh, aircraft structure
